Gear pump selection for Caldas starts with viscosity at the real pumping temperature — not the 40 °C catalog figure — the typical case of óleos e água industrial. With that data, engineering defines speed (flow is proportional), bushing materials and the thermal arrangement: jacketed body for cold starts and a seal compatible with the hot fluid.

There is no single configuration — engineering selects the mechanical seal based on the fluid, temperature and operating pressure. The range includes single seals, double seals in tandem or back-to-back arrangement, cartridge seals and packing glands in specific applications. When the fluid is hazardous, the recommendation is a double seal with barrier.

The FBCN series complies with ASME B73.1 (North American standard for horizontal end-suction process centrifugal pumps) — which enables retrofit on existing baseplates in Caldas plants, whoever manufactured the installed unit, provided the dimension designation matches. Shaft dimensions, suction/discharge flanges, casing feet and impeller centerline follow the standard: the complete FBCN pump goes in and piping and baseplate stay put.

Limits vary by series. FBE and FBEI: up to 350°C, provided a heating jacket and special sealing are used. FBOT: up to 350°C in thermal oil circuits. FBCN: up to 260°C, with materials and sealing suited to the service. Well-sized sealing and materials are a condition for safe operation in these ranges.
Four families are manufactured in Cabreúva/SP: external gear FBE and internal gear FBEI for viscous fluids, standardized centrifugal FBCN for low-viscosity liquids and FBOT for thermal oil circuits up to 350 °C. Fire-fighting systems per NFPA 20 / NBR 16704 complete the line.

In a normalized centrifugal retrofit, ASME B73.1 requires that units of the same standard dimension designation, from any source of supply, be interchangeable as to mounting dimensions, suction and discharge nozzles, input shaft and foundation bolt holes.
